APC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2014 in Review

894 of the 3,463 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Anadarko Petroleum (APC) for Q1 2014, worth a combined $36.6B — up 7.3% from $34.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 95 funds opened new APC positions and 74 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 287 added to existing stakes and 357 trimmed.

The largest buyer was HSBC Holdings, adding an estimated $302M. The largest seller was Mason Capital Management, cutting an estimated $199M.
